Andrew Marcus

Chief Operating Officer

Andrew Marcus joined Relativity in 2005.
At Relativity, Marcus manages all company operations and staff, oversees business development, financial analysis, deal execution and financing for all transactions including the Beverly Blvd. film co-finance transactions with Sony and Universal, the acquisition of Rogue Pictures from Universal and all single picture transactions.  Prior to joining Relativity, Marcus worked at Ackman-Ziff performing valuation and underwriting analyses on real estate assets, optimizing transaction structures and sourcing equity and debt financing.  Marcus’s entertainment industry experience includes work with Magnetic Films where he consulted corporations and investors on entertainment transactions; GreeneStreet Films, where he managed feature film production, from development through distribution, including the Academy-Award nominated In The Bedroom.  While at GreeneStreet he structured a revolving credit facility for internal development and funding of film and television projects; and Miramax Films, where he served as an assistant to Harvey Weinstein.

Marcus began his career working in film production and finance with companies including Manifest Films, The Shooting Gallery, Gun for Hire and worked on several features, including Howard Stern’s Private Parts and What’s Your Sign?.

Marcus received his B.A. from Duke University and received his M.B.A. from Harvard Business School.
